>Retail 4Q, 2006 E-commerce Report, Census, 3/8/2007
>The Census Bureau of the Department of Commerce
>announced today that the estimate of U.S. retail
>e-commerce sales for the fourth quarter of 2006,
>adjusted for seasonal variation and holiday and
>trading-day differences, but not for price changes,
>was $29.3 billion, an increase of 6.3 percent (±2.8%)
>from the third quarter of 2006.

>Palo Alto Moves Forward With FTTH - Picks 180Connect
>for $41 million long-delayed build..., Broadband
>Reports, 3/8/2007
>The city of Palo Alto, California, was one of the very
>first cities to explore building their own broadband
>network. In fact, they laid dark fiber infrastructure
>as early as 1996 and used a limited portion of that
>network to conduct fiber trials.
